**14:22** — Digest scheduler on Pigeonpost started double-sending because the batch window overlapped after the DST shift. Classic. Marnie paused the queue, we deduped pending digests, and shipped a patch pinning windows to UTC. Nobody outside the pilot group got dupes. Full fix went out in the hotfix build, identified by the token below.

pipeline stamp: htk21_86b657ac0aa916a9af17f

[ ] Score sheets from the Penmarsh Regional Chess Final — grab the sealed folder from the records cabinet (top shelf, red tab) for tomorrow's off-site run. They're the originals, so no loose copies riding along. Quick count: should be 48 sheets plus the arbiter's summary from Ilsa Brandt. Sign the out-log before you leave. For the courier hand-over, do exactly what's written below.

drop instructions, fajop-fajep: the druix oliox courier leaves the kelix ulaox normir ulador briath kasax gorys oliir ledger at gate 3848 under passcode 120698

**Ticket: Catalogue import failing on staging — bad env**

Release manager: hold the Fennimore Library v3.2 cut. The MARC import job on staging fails at auth against the Shelfwright ingest API. Root cause: `.env` was copied from dev and lacks the ingest credential, so every batch 401s. Fix is one line in `/opt/shelfwright/import.env`; append the ingest secret directly below:

secret setting of yajog-taguf: ARCHIVE_KEY3=051

TICKET-4182: Lintbase baseline upload failing since Tuesday. The credential used by the Sandervik static-analysis baseline job expired; every push now regenerates the full baseline instead of diffing. Rotate the key, update the CI secret store, and re-run the baseline sync. New key below for the Lintbase ingest service.

gateway credential: zpat4_qSKI

// Dispatch tuning for the Liftwright elevator simulator.
// On-call: these constants govern car assignment cost weights and
// door-dwell timing. If sim runs diverge from the Harrowgate bench
// traces, suspect the idle-repark interval first — it dominates
// morning-peak wait times. Do not change weights independently;
// they are normalized as a set. Regenerate golden traces after any
// edit and attach them to the change. Current calibrated values
// follow immediately below.

tuning table, yajog-yahof:
BUDGETS = {
    "lamvan": 303,
    "wenox": 460,
    "fenvan": 525,
}